Output ddf587b14190847333271ba1315465e5384740c018685f1945bb22b6219d521e:0

value
161905867
script pubkey
OP_0 OP_PUSHBYTES_20 defd4ad1e4c2900a659b8c770677bdfb21c1555b
address
bc1qmm75450yc2gq5evm33msvaaalvsuz42m6c7w9c
transaction
ddf587b14190847333271ba1315465e5384740c018685f1945bb22b6219d521e
spent
true